Taxonomic Classification

Rank Oriente Cave Rat Pinkfish
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Echinodermata (Echinoderms)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Holothuroidea (Holothuroidea)
Order Rodentia (Rodents) Holothuriida (Holothuriida)
Family Echimyidae Holothuriidae
Genus Boromys Holothuria
Species Boromys offella Holothuria edulis

Evolutionary Relationship

Oriente Cave Rat and Pinkfish share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
